Meetings on Organized Employment and the Safety of Uzbek Citizens held in the Kurgan Region of Russia

KURGAN, August 24. /Dunyo IA/. Diplomats of the Consulate General of Uzbekistan in Yekaterinburg held meetings with prospective employers as part of efforts to develop labour migration and promote the organized employment of Uzbek citizens abroad, reports Dunyo IA correspondent.

During a visit to Russia’s Kurgan Region, a meeting was held with Oleg Chernyak, Head of Kurganstalmost JSC, and responsible representatives of the enterprise. Parties discussed prospects for the further organized employment of Uzbek citizens at the company.

Following the meeting with the company’s management, a dialogue was held with Uzbek compatriots temporarily working at the enterprise.

The meeting highlighted the consistent efforts undertaken by the leadership of Uzbekistan to protect the rights and legitimate interests of its citizens regardless of their place of residence abroad. The compatriots were reminded of the importance of observing public order, rules of conduct, and the legislation of the Russian Federation, as well as their personal responsibility for contributing to a positive image of Uzbekistan abroad.

Particular attention was devoted to preventing offenses. Participants were informed that there have been cases of individuals being recruited through social media into activities associated with religious extremism, terrorism, and illicit trafficking in narcotic drugs. Compatriots were advised to exercise vigilance when using online resources and not to fall victim to offers or provocations that could lead to unlawful activities.

As part of preventive efforts, a separate discussion was also held on the risks of being drawn into various unlawful activities and the importance of critically assessing suspicious offers received through the internet and social media.

In addition, separate meetings were held with four Uzbek compatriots engaged in entrepreneurial activities in the Kurgan Region and creating temporary employment opportunities for Uzbek citizens.

During the meetings, entrepreneurs were advised to strengthen awareness-raising efforts among Uzbek citizens working under their supervision in light of the increasing number of unmanned aerial vehicle attacks reported in certain regions of Russia. Particular emphasis was placed on the need to observe safety measures and prevent employees from becoming involved in unlawful activities.

Such meetings contribute to strengthening cooperation with employers and Uzbek compatriots, expanding opportunities for the organized employment of Uzbek citizens, and enhancing their legal awareness and safety during their stay abroad.
